Disappointed and Hiatal Hernia

So yesterday I had the EDG (scope) as I'm progressing towards surgery. My preference is the gastric sleeve, well they found a Hiatal Hernia :-( So now the option is gastric bypass. I'm not wanting to go that route at all ! I don't know what to do now. I have a follow up appointment in two weeks.

Has anyone had a Hiatal Hernia and still was able to have VSG?

I was told the same thing and i was so mad because it took me a year to decide to do the sleeve that i had a melt down on my doc. Afterwards we spoke and he advised it all depended on how bad the hernia was and agreed to review my case again with radiologist and his surgical team. A week later the sleeve was back in play. I got sleeved, esophageal hiatal hernia repair and gall bladder removal 1.6.17 and thankfully all went well. Have a talk with your doc. Good luck.
